Dani didn't know what to do. She had taken a wrong turn while trying to visit Pandora, and dropped headfirst into a battle between a bunch of scary robots. Unfortunately, she was dropped in full ghost mode, tiara of flames and all. She didn't have much time to think before one of the big purple ones threw her into its belly and took off.

Heatwave heard screams, and turned around just in time for Optimus to fail to catch the floating, obviously not human girl being taken by a Morbot.

Blades chases after the main Morbot, the girl pounding on the door and attempting to freeze the door off. She finally shifted to a more human appearance, with long black hair and a simple t-shirt and shorts, tears and snot dripping down her face.

As soon as they land, Morocco has a camera drone on her. She babbles in multiple languages in a blind panic, including a few dead ones. Morocco straps her onto a metal table and turns on his computer. On the screen, several anonymous bidders waited for Morocco to start the auction.

"Bidding will start at my usual, four hundred thousand dollars." He said, rolling a cart with a spread of sharp objects and pliers. "Of course," He said, picking up a scalpel, "you will need proof that she truly is supernatural."

"DANNY! PHANTOM!" She screamed, as the scalpel bit into her skin. Green streaked blood trickled from the wound. She kicked, and managed to push Morocco away. The number displayed behind them on the computer ticks up and up.

Then the lights go out.

Even flashlights as the room is consumed by a horribly cold darkness, unusual in the warm summer afternoon. The bot's biolights don't reach past their noses. Optimus puts a protective arm between him and his chest.

Morocco screamed in pain, the sound of metal hitting bone echoing in Morocco's lab, and everyone went silent.

Suddenly, a glowing green portal exploded into space, the lights coming back on with a surge that smelled of smoke and singed human flesh.

Morocco was pinned to the bank of computers by the scalpel he used to prove that Dani wasn't human, a figure dressed in black with a cape of woven souls and a crown of burning blue fire hovering over his head. At least, Optimus could assume they were male. His booming voice certainly sounded male.

"You… You will pay for auctioning my sister to those monsters." He took out the scalpel, Morocco screaming in pain. He spit on the scalpel, green and glowing, and stabbed his other hand. The wound steamed, and Morocco's screams reached a new register.

"You will never harm another child again. Not her, not him," Danny grabbed his face and made him look into Optimus's cab, looking Cody in the eyes. "Never again. Clockwork told me all about how you stole him away, took away his family's livelihoods and threatened the lives of five beings that are not yours. Not humanity's to claim."

He turned around, and revealed that he wasn't much older than Cody. He kneeled next to the girl, who was still crying and holding her cut arm. The glowing green and red blood had stemmed, the skin already knitting back together. He put a big rainbow bandaid on the already closed cut and kissed it.

He looked up at the Burns and the Rescue Bots, frozen where they stood. He wasn't much older than Cody, the girl next to him younger than both of them. He had hauntingly world-weary eyes and eyebags. He looked like he had been crying.
